Ben Youngs out for the season after shoulder surgery
Ben Youngs had an operation on his shoulder and will consequently miss the rest of Leicester Tigers’ Premiership campaign.
England and Leicester Tigers scrum-half Ben Youngs will miss the remainder of the Premiership season after undergoing shoulder surgery.
Youngs sustained the injury while representing England in the Six Nations, with his last appearance for club or country being the 38-38 draw with Scotland at Twickenham on March 16.
The Tigers confirmed the 29-year-old had an operation on his shoulder this week and was unavailable for their final five Premiership fixtures.
Youngs became England’s most-capped scrum-half by making his 85th Test appearance versus Scotland.
The British and Irish Lion will be hopeful of recovering in time to form part of Eddie Jones’ squad for the Rugby World Cup, which begins in September.
